Answer:

66°

Explanation:

For this type of question, first you should know that all the three angles of a triangle sum up to 180°. Let's say the three angles are ∠a, ∠b and ∠c, so if we add the values of all these three angles they would always be equal to 180°.

In this question, we are given the measure of two angles and are asked to find the third angle:

75° + 39° + ? = 180°

? = 180° - 75° + 39°

? = 66° Answer
